Yeah. I was just looking at some July temp departures down this way and MMK, HVN, DXR are all like +5. It's been an absolute furnace down here. 

Up here too.  The mountain valley radiator sites are getting crushed.  Burlington doesn't radiate to begin with, so the departures aren't as big but still +3.

Morrisville-Stowe ASOS... +5.2

Montpelier ASOS... +4.9

Saint Johnsbury ASOS... +4.8

Burlington ASOS... +3.1

Getting +3 to +5 in the peak warm season months is absolutely crazy.  Winter has higher variance so you can get the +/- 5s or whatever, but summer variance used to be 1-2 degrees from normal and that's it.
